The "black" in "blacksmith" refers to the black firescale [citation needed], a layer of oxides that forms on the surface of the metal during heating.The origin of "smith" is debated, it may come from the old English word "smythe" meaning "to strike" [citation needed] or it may have originated from the Proto-German "smithaz" meaning "skilled worker." The peen in straight peen hammer is positioned parallel in proportion to a handle whereas peen of the crossed one is located perpendicular.
